The John Boos UBBS-2112 Underbar Blender Station is a commercial-grade, freestanding foodservice workstation designed for efficient beverage preparation and cleanup. Crafted from durable 18/300 stainless steel, this underbar station measures 12" wide by 21" deep with an overall height of 32-1/2". It features a recessed dump sink with a 10" W x 8" front-to-back x 6" deep fabricating bowl, complemented by a 3-1/2" backsplash to contain splashes. Integrated with a set of removable splash mount faucet holes with 4" centers, it offers seamless plumbing integration. The model combines robust construction with convenient design features tailored for high-volume bar, beverage, and cocktail stations, providing a streamlined solution for efficient workflow in busy commercial environments.

The John Boos UBBS-2112 Underbar Blender Station features a robust stainless steel construction, supporting commercial kitchen demands with a height of 32-1/2" and overall footprint of 12" x 21". It is a freestanding unit compatible with various bar setups, with a weight of 29 lbs. The built-in dump sink measures 10" wide by 8" deep and 6" deep, supporting quick waste disposal. It includes a 3-1/2" backsplash to contain spills and a set of removable faucet holes with 4" centers for flexible plumbing. The unit's NSF compliance ensures suitability for foodservice environments, and its design supports a maximum safe operating temperature compatible with typical bar and prep kitchen temperatures. Disassembly for cleaning is straightforward, with stainless steel surfaces resistant to corrosion and easy to sanitize.
